The Regulatory Framework: Safety First
Unlike numerous retail sectors where e-commerce operates with broad autonomy, the online sale of pharmaceuticals in Spain is strictly regulated by the Spanish Agency for Medicines and Health Products (Agencia Española Tienda De AnalgéSicos En EspañA Medicamentos y Productos Sanitarios, or AEMPS) and the Ministry of Health.
The essential guideline governing Spain's online drug store market is simple: only authorized, brick-and-mortar pharmacies are allowed to offer medications online. Purely digital stores or web-only operations without a physical dispensary are strictly prohibited. Additionally, Spanish law dictates that only non-prescription medications (Over-The-Counter or OTC drugs) can be sold via the web. Prescription-only medicines (medicamentos sujetos a prescripción médica) can not be acquired online.
